As a plant-based chef (embracing all eating preferences- from vegans to carnivores and everyone in between!) with a big appetite for wholesome, locally grown, delicious food, I have spent many years exploring the connection between food, well-being, community, and the planet.
From co-owning Pomegranate Café—a beloved mother-daughter owned, organic, indulgently healthy eatery—to working as a holistic private chef creating culinary nutrition plans & preparing nourishing meals for individuals with chronic health conditions, to creating a wellness curriculum and teaching hands-on cooking classes with children of all ages & abilities, I am inspired by the healing power of whole foods.
I have always been hungry for more: more flavor, more color, more creative & delicious ways to nourish our bodies and care for the Earth.
I studied culinary nutrition and graduated from the chef’s training program at The Natural Gourmet Institute in New York City. In addition to my culinary training, I have continued my education in Food as Medicine to deepen my understanding of nutrition and holistic health.
One of my greatest joys is working with children. As the Wellness Education Coordinator at Desert Garden Montessori, I guide children in cultivating a healthy relationship with food, their bodies & Mother Earth.
I also love bringing communities together through hands-on cooking classes, where kids, teens, and adults learn to prepare simple, nourishing meals that are as fun to make as they are to eat.
